Wolverines blank Bethany

BETHANY, W. Va. -- Freshman Andrew Quinn (Damascus, Md./Damascus) scored the first two goals of his collegiate career Wednesday night to help vault the Grove City College men's soccer team to a 2-0 win over Presidents' Athletic Conference rival Bethany at Bison Stadium.

Quinn broke a scoreless tie at the 7:31 mark with an unassisted goal, his first of the season. He then scored an insurance goal -- also unassisted -- at 87:16 to help seal the win.

Grove City (5-7-1, 2-1 PAC) owned a 27-3 edge in shots. The Wolverines also had 11 corner kicks, compared to just one for Bethany (1-13, 0-2). Senior goalkeeper Sean Osborne (Manassas, Va./Osbourn) made one save to preserve Grove City's sixth shutout of the season.

Grove City is 2-0-1 in its last three trips to Bethany. The Wolverines won last year's meeting in Grove City 2-0.

Grove City will host Waynesburg Saturday at 12 p.m. in PAC action.
